Authoxy runs locally as a proxy server to intercept HTTP and HTTPS requests for Mac OS X
DESCRIPTION
If your connection to the Internet requires authenticating to a HTTP proxy, as is the case in many Australian universities, you may well have discovered that with Mac OS X, including Jaguar, many applications which require an Internet connection will simply fail. Some prominent examples are Software Update, MacHelp, parts of Quicktime, parts of iTunes (CDDB, Net Radio), and Sherlock. This is rather limiting. Authoxy is my solution. I run it full time now, and never have to worry about authenticating with the proxy again.
REQUIREMENTS
Mac OS X 10.2 or later.
(NOTE: A version for Mac OS X 10.1 is also on the Download page.)
